mac_ターミナル_python_requirements.txt_実行コマンド



macでpytonのライブラリをインストールする場合、


selenium with python,


custom tk inter をインストールしたい場合の


requirements.txtへは


どのように記述すればいいのでしょうか?


そして、それをどのフォルダに配置して、


どのようなコマンドを実行すればいいのでしょうか?


コマンドの実行は

zshが動いているターミナルでよろしいでしょうか?


    ↓


### 1. `requirements.txt` の記述方法

`requirements.txt` に以下のように記述します。



```txt


selenium

customtkinter


```


※ `selenium` は通常のパッケージ名でインストールできます。


※ `customtkinter` も PyPI にあるため、

同じく `pip install` でインストール可能です。


---


### 2. `requirements.txt` を配置する場所


プロジェクトのルートディレクトリ

(Pythonスクリプトがあるフォルダ)に配置します。


例:

```

/Users/your_username/projects/my_python_app/


    ├── main.py

    ├── requirements.txt  ← ここに配置


```


---


### 3. コマンドの実行方法


ターミナル(zsh)を開いて、

`requirements.txt` があるディレクトリへ移動し、

以下のコマンドを実行します。


#### ① `cd` コマンドでフォルダ移動


```zsh


cd /Users/your_username/projects/my_python_app/


```


#### ② `pip` で `requirements.txt` を使ってインストール


```zsh


pip install -r requirements.txt


```

これで `selenium` と 

`customtkinter` がインストールされます。


---


### 4. (推奨) 仮想環境を使う場合


**仮想環境を作成してインストールするのが推奨されます。**


#### ① 仮想環境の作成(`venv` を使用)


```zsh


python3 -m venv venv


```


#### ② 仮想環境を有効化


```zsh


source venv/bin/activate


```

(仮想環境が有効になると、

プロンプトの先頭に `(venv)` が表示されます。)


#### ③ `requirements.txt` からインストール


```zsh


pip install -r requirements.txt


```


#### ④ 仮想環境の終了(必要に応じて)


```zsh


deactivate


```


---


### 5. `pip list` でインストール確認


```zsh


pip list


```

`selenium` や `customtkinter` が

リストに表示されていればインストール成功です。


---


### 6. `python` 実行時の注意点


- `python` コマンドで `customtkinter` を試す場合は、

    仮想環境を有効にした状態で実行してください。


- `selenium` を使用する場合は、

    WebDriver(例: ChromeDriver)

    のセットアップも必要になる場合があります。


---


### まとめ

#### `requirements.txt` の書き方:


```txt


selenium

customtkinter


```

#### インストール方法:


```zsh


pip install -r requirements.txt


```

#### 仮想環境を使う場合:


```zsh


python3 -m venv venv


source venv/bin/activate


pip install -r requirements.txt


```

`zsh` での実行で問題ありません。


コメント